Warning Signs You Need Category 2 Water Damage Restoration

Catching Category 2 water damage early is crucial in preventing long-term consequences. Keep an eye out for these warning signs, and don’t hesitate to contact our team if you suspect you have a Category 2 water damage issue.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of bacteria, viruses, or mold in your property.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the source and take corrective action.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of underlying water damage. If you notice any changes in the appearance or texture of your flooring, it’s crucial to investigate further to find out the cause and address it quickly.

Visible Water Stains or Leaks

Visible water stains or leaks can show a range of issues, from simple plumbing problems to more complex water damage scenarios.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can quickly escalate into more significant problems.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Mold growth can be a sign of underlying water damage or high humidity levels. If you notice any mold growth in your property,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your property can show underlying structural damage or water damage. If you notice any unusual noises, it’s crucial to investigate further to find out the cause and address it quickly.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Visible signs of water damage, such as water spots, mineral deposits, or rust, can show a range of issues.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the cause and address it quickly.

Category 2 Water Damage Cost in Parrish, FL

The cost of Category 2 water damage restoration can vary a lot dep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Parrish, FL. Our team provides a free consultation and assessment to find out the scope of the project and provide a clear, itemized estimate of the costs involved.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and the type of equipment required.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 The extent of the contamination, the type of cleaning solutions required, and the equipment used.
Reconstruction and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age, the type of materials required, and the labor involved.
Equipment Rental and Usage $100 – $500 The type of equipment required, the duration of rental, and the usage fees.
Consultation and Assessment Free The complexity of the project, the scope of the work, and the expertise required.
Permits and Inspections $100 – $500 The type of permits required, the frequency of inspections, and the associated fees.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a clear understanding of your specific needs. Our team provides free estimates and consultations to ensure you have a comprehensive understanding of the costs involved.
